The importance of ESG for a business

ESG, which stands for Environmental, Social, and Governance, has become increasingly important for businesses in recent years. This framework is used to evaluate a company's ethical and sustainable practices, and it has gained prominence as investors, consumers, and stakeholders are placing more emphasis on corporate social responsibility.

The importance of ESG for a business cannot be understated, as it plays a crucial role in shaping the long-term success and reputation of a company. Here are some reasons why ESG is essential for businesses:

First and foremost, adopting ESG practices can help a business mitigate risks and ensure long-term sustainability. Companies that prioritize environmental sustainability, social responsibility, and good governance are more likely to avoid costly regulatory fines, lawsuits, and reputational damage. By addressing these issues proactively, businesses can protect themselves from potential liabilities and ensure their operations are in compliance with ethical standards.

Furthermore, ESG can also drive innovation and efficiency within a company. By integrating sustainable practices into their operations, companies can reduce waste, cut costs, and improve operational efficiency. This not only benefits the environment but also enhances the company's bottom line. For example, investing in renewable energy sources can help reduce energy costs in the long run, while promoting diversity and inclusion can lead to a more engaged and productive workforce.

In addition, adopting ESG practices can also enhance a company's reputation and brand value. Consumers are increasingly conscious of the impact of their purchasing decisions on the environment and society, and they are more likely to support businesses that demonstrate a commitment to ESG principles. By aligning their values with those of their customers, businesses can build trust and loyalty, which can ultimately lead to increased sales and market share.

Moreover, ESG can also attract and retain top talent. In today's competitive job market, employees are increasingly looking for employers that prioritize sustainability, social responsibility, and ethical practices. By showcasing their commitment to ESG, businesses can attract and retain top talent, foster a positive company culture, and improve employee satisfaction and loyalty.

Overall, the importance of ESG for a business cannot be overstated. By adopting ethical and sustainable practices, companies can mitigate risks, drive innovation, enhance their reputation, attract top talent, and ultimately, ensure long-term success. In today's increasingly interconnected and socially conscious world, businesses that prioritize ESG are better positioned to thrive and make a positive impact on society and the environment.
